The ingredients needed to make Falafel:
- Prepare 1 can chickpeas
- Prepare 1/4 c onion
- Take 1/4 c carrot
- Take 1 tsp fresh ginger
- Get 3 cloves garlic
- Make ready 1/4 c parsley
- Prepare 1/4 c cilantro
- Make ready 1/4 tsp salt and pepper
- Make ready Healthy pinch of cardamom
- Take Healthy pinch coriander
- Get 1 1/2 tsp cumin
- Make ready 2 tbsp almonds or seasonings seeds
- Make ready 2-3 tbsp flour
- Prepare Vegetable oil for frying

Instructions to make Falafel:
- Lay chickpeas on paper towels to dry for a couple of hours. If using dry beans, soak overnight, then lay out to dry.
- Add all ingredients (except for chickpeas and flour) to food processor and pulse. Don't over blend, you do not want a puree, just coarsely blend. Be sure and scrape down the sides periodically. Transfer into medium sized bowl.
- Add chickpeas to food processor and pulse until it's the same consistency as the other ingredients. Add to your bowl of vegetables and spices.
- Adding one tbsp of flour at a time, fold ingredients together with a spatula. Then, cover and place in fridge for one hour.
- Add between 1/4 to 1/2 inch of vegetable oil to frying pan. Make patties and fry on medium heat until deep golden brown on each side.
- I served mine with a mixture of Greek yogurt and preserved lemons.
